Git拒绝在linux下切换分支。
我已经初始化了我的项目。python分支存在于linux上,当我发出以下命令时,我可以看到它:
git branch -a | grep python remotes/origin/python
但是在linux下,git拒绝切换到python分支。
观看:
git branch
* master
然后我就做了:
git checkout python
再次检查分支:
git branch
* master
重试:
git checkout origin python
再次检查,仍然在master下:
git branch
* master
最后再试一次:
git checkout --force python
仍然在同一个分支中。我在大师班:
git branch
* master
我甚至尝试删除整个目录,并再次将其签出。同样的事情。我无法切换到linux下名为python
的分支。
在windows上,这工作得很好。我可以来回切换。但我也需要在Linux上进行测试。
为什么git不执行我的命令来切换分支?
发布于 2019-04-17 02:22:25
python分支存在吗?
试一试
git checkout -b python.
-b将创建分支。
发布于 2019-04-17 02:34:15
应从遥控器中拉出分支。
尝试:git pull origin python
那就去看看吧。
发布于 2019-04-17 03:31:10
有时,使用可视化工具会很有帮助。这没什么丢人的。你有没有尝试过像GitKraken这样的工具?它可用于Linux。
https://stackoverflow.com/questions/55714277
复制相似问题